Warning Signs You Need Structural Repair After Water Damage
Don’t ignore these warning signs, they can lead to costly repairs and safety hazards. Stay vigilant and address these issues ASAP.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can show hidden moisture and mold growth. Don’t ignore the smell it’s a sign of a bigger problem.
Water Stains on Ceilings and Walls
Water stains can be a sign of hidden damage and structural issues. Don’t wait until it’s too late address the problem ASAP.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age and structural issues. Get it fixed before it’s too late.
Cracks in Walls and Foundations
Cracks in walls and foundations can be a sign of structural issues and water damage. Don’t ignore the cracks they can lead to bigger problems.
Mold Growth in Hidden Areas
Mold growth in hidden areas, such as attics and crawl spaces, can be a sign of water damage and structural issues. Don’t ignore the mold it’s a sign of a bigger problem.
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When to Call a Pro
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Hidden water damage behind walls | No | Yes | Hidden damage can lead to costly repairs and safety hazards. |
| Small water leak under sink | Yes | No | Small leaks can be fixed with basic plumbing tools and knowledge. |
| Structural damage to foundation or walls | No | Yes | Structural damage needs specialized expertise and equipment to repair safely and effectively. |
| Water damage in multiple rooms | No | Yes | Water damage in multiple rooms needs a comprehensive approach to repair and prevent further damage. |
| Unknown source of water damage | No | Yes | Unknown sources of water damage need specialized expertise to identify and repair. |
| Water damage after a storm or flood | No | Yes | Water damage after a storm or flood needs specialized expertise and equipment to repair and prevent further damage. |

Structural Repair After Water Damage Cost in Hanover, MA
The cost of structural repair after water damage can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in Hanover, MA. These estimates are based on real-world costs and can help you plan your budget. Get a clear picture of the costs involved.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Inspection |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and complexity of repairs |
| Demolition and Removal |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ials removed, and complexity of repairs |
| Structural Repair and Reinforcement | $2,000 – $10,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and complexity of repairs |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and complexity of repairs |
| Final Inspection and Cleanup |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and complexity of repairs |
| More Services (e.g., mold remediation, asbestos removal) |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and complexity of repairs |
